Develop a Comprehensive Cleansing Checklist
Producing a detailed cleansing checklist can make your Airbnb turnover procedure smoother and much more effective. Begin by detailing all areas in your space, including bed rooms, shower rooms, cooking area, and living locations. Break down each area into particular tasks. For instance, in the kitchen area, include wiping down countertops, cleaning up appliances, and washing meals.
Do not neglect the information-- look for dust on surfaces, tidy mirrors, and vacuum cleaner rugs. Include laundry jobs like transforming bedding and towels, as fresh linens can leave a long lasting impression.
By following this checklist, you'll simplify your cleansing process, reduce stress, and assure your guests arrive to a spick-and-span atmosphere. Plus, a tidy home enhances visitor fulfillment and encourages favorable reviews, which is essential for your Airbnb success.

Utilize the Right Cleaning Products
After taking on the high-traffic locations, it's time to show on the cleaning items you utilize. Choosing the appropriate cleaning supplies can make all the distinction in accomplishing a pristine room that wows your guests.
Don't forget disinfectants-- specifically in cooking areas and washrooms. Make specific they're EPA-approved for maximum performance against bacteria. Microfiber fabrics are important for dusting and cleaning down surfaces given that they capture dust without scraping.
For floorings, find a cleaner suitable for your floor covering type, whether it's laminate, hardwood, or floor tile. Think about including a pleasurable aroma with air fresheners or crucial oils, as a fresh-smelling space enhances the overall experience. Your selection of items can truly boost your Airbnb's sanitation and setting.

How Can I Manage Cleansing After a Pet Dog Stay?
After an animal remain, vacuum completely to get rid of hair, usage enzyme cleansers for discolorations, and clean all bed linens. Do not forget to air out the space and check for any remaining odors to ensure freshness.
